
Women of UGA provides enrichment programs for women affiliated with the University. This is a collaborative initiative between the UGA Alumni Association and various colleges and departments across the University. All female students, faculty, staff, and alumnae are welcome to attend. Programming will focus on professional skill development, social activities, and community initiatives. Mission:
Provide a forum for women of UGA to connect with one another for personal and professional growth
Goals:
- Community - Create a sense of community for women across UGA to connect with one another and build relationships
- Empowerment - Provide programming for women across UGA that develops their skills and empowers them to achieve their professional goals
- Service - Coordinate and support volunteer initiatives geared towards women and girls
Programming:
- Professional Development - Potential topics for these fee-based seminars include: Leadership seminars; Communication skills; Networking skills; Career management; Panel presentations; Wellness seminars; Building your own business; Financial Planning; Power and presence
- Service/Community Involvement - Potential projects include: Volunteering at social service organizations focused on serving women and girls; Mentoring female UGA students or alumnae; serving on boards and committees at UGA
- Social Activities - Potential activities include: Wine tastings; Book clubs; Cooking demos; Golf/tennis clinics; Poetry readings
